There is no better way to look great for the New Year than wearing clothes that would make you look like a million bucks! Taboos about Chinese New Year Clothes Do Not Wear Black. Never wear clothes in black during the Chinese New year because it is typically worn during funerals. The color has been associated with death. Red is the most popular and important color to wear during Chinese New Year. It symbolizes luck, happiness, and prosperity. Many people choose to wear red clothing or accessories to ward off bad luck and attract good fortune. Gold is another auspicious color to wear during Chinese New Year. It represents wealth, success, and prosperity. The traditional way to dress for Chinese New Year is to wear a qipao or a cheongsam frock. Leaf advised that traditionally you would wear this in red. To keep bad luck away during Chinese New Year, you should wear vibrant colors like red and gold. These hues are believed to attract positive energy and fortune. Red, in particular, symbolizes joy and happiness, while gold represents wealth and prosperity.
